Carlos Delgado is a former professional baseball player from Puerto Rico who played as a first baseman in Major League Baseball (MLB) from 1993 to 2009. He is most recognized for his time with the Toronto Blue Jays, but also played for the Florida Marlins and the New York Mets. He was elected to the Canadian Baseball Hall of Fame in 2015.
Delgado’s career spanned 17 seasons, during which he was known as a powerful left-handed slugger. A significant highlight of his career occurred on September 25, 2003, when he became one of only a handful of players in MLB history to hit four home runs in a single game.
Throughout his career, Delgado earned several prestigious awards and recognitions. He is a two-time All-Star (2000, 2003), Three-time Silver Slugger Award winner (1999, 2000, 2003) and 2000 American League (AL) Hank Aaron Award winner.
In 2006, he was honored with the Roberto Clemente Award, which is given to the player who best exemplifies humanitarianism and sportsmanship. This award recognized his extensive charitable work, including founding the non-profit organization “Extra Bases,” which focuses on improving the lives of children in Canada, the United States, and Puerto Rico.
